The Gardens of Waterford offers competitive pricing for its various room types compared to the broader market in Montgomery County and the state of Alabama. For a one-bedroom accommodation, residents can expect to pay $3,800, which is notably higher than the county average of $2,987 but remains lower than the statewide average of $3,417. Those seeking more privacy may consider the private rooms priced at $3,996; this is marginally above both the county rate of $3,919 and the state average of $4,158. Studio apartments are offered at a rate of $4,800, reflecting a premium over the county's average of $3,265 and statewide figure of $3,279. Overall, while The Gardens of Waterford's costs tend to trend higher in comparison to local options, they reflect a commitment to providing quality living environments tailored to residents' needs.

How and When Medicaid May Cover Assisted Living Costs
Medicaid coverage for assisted living varies by state and is primarily available to low-income individuals, with eligibility dependent on strict income and asset limits. Some states offer HCBS waivers for specific services in assisted living, but families must generally cover room and board costs, and should verify facility acceptance of Medicaid while considering potential waiting lists.
A Detailed Exploration of Assisted Living Medicaid Waivers Across the United States
Medicaid waivers for assisted living services provide vital support for seniors and individuals with disabilities in need of long-term care, with varying state-specific eligibility criteria and benefits. These waivers cover personal care and case management but often do not fully cover room and board, leading to waiting lists for many applicants.
